    Default Target Toy Sale Wednesday 26th of June

    The public awareness campaign has begun for Target's toy sale, with over 300 exclusive toys and their standard price match guarantee. Details and updates on their website can be found here.
    No word yet wether they'll start at 9am or do what they did last year and shut the stores from 5pm and go on sale from 6pm. Either way they'll be starting before Big W


    TARGET (June 26 - July 17)
    Catalogue
    Platinum Ultra Magnus - $39 (save $40) TARGET EXCL
    Ultimate Optimus Prime - $59 (save $20)
    Ultimate Predaking - $59 (save $20)
    TFPrime Weaponizer - $20 (save $22)
